Galaxy Group in Macau Reports Revenue Increase for H1 2024

Macau’s Galaxy Entertainment Group has published its results for Q2 and the H1 of 2024.

For the H1 of the year, the group’s net revenue reached HK$ 21.5 billion (USD 2.76 billion), a 37% increase compared to the same period last year. Net profit attributable to shareholders rose by 52%, reaching HK$4.4 billion, while adjusted EBITDA grew by 37% to HK$ 6.0 billion compared to the previous year.

In Q2, net revenue amounted to HK$10.9 billion, a 26% increase from the same period last year and a 12% increase from the previous quarter. Adjusted EBITDA rose by 28% year-over-year and 12% quarter-over-quarter, reaching HK$ 3.2 billion.

Among the companies showing significant growth were Galaxy Macau with revenue of HK$ 17 billion, StarWorld Macau with HK$ 2.7 billion, and Broadway Macau, which had an adjusted EBITDA of HK$ 8 million.

In addition to financial reports, Galaxy announced plans to open Capella in Galaxy Macau by mid-2025, as well as the completion of Cotai Phase 3, which includes GICC, Galaxy Arena, Raffles at Galaxy Macau, and Andaz Macau. The company also revealed plans for Cotai Phase 4, focused on non-gaming entertainment and family-oriented venues.

Besides Galaxy, Melco also reported a 22% increase in its Macau business revenue. MGM China reported a 52% rise in net revenue for Q2, coinciding with Macau’s announcement of a 11.6% year-over-year increase in gross gaming revenue for July.
